  A: There are innumerable reasons why I can’t marry you.

  B: Surely there can not be that many .

  innumerable

  a. 无数的,数不清的

  A: I would love to sail around the world alone.

  B: You must be insane.

  insane

  a. 1.蠢极的,荒唐的;2.(患)精神病的,精神失常的,疯狂的

  A: Can you read the inscription in the book to me?

  B: Sorry, I don’t have my glasses and the lettering it too small.

  inscription

  n. 铭文,碑文,题字

  A: You are looking tired.

  B: Yes, I am suffering from insomnia.

  insomnia

  n. 失眠(症)

  A: You are an inspiration to me.

  B: You are quite amazing also!

  inspiration

  n. 1.灵感;2.鼓舞人心的人(或事物)

  A: Did you buy your car with cash?

  B: No, I arranged that I will pay in monthly installments.

  installment

  n. 1.分期付款,分期交付;2.(分期连载的)部分

  A: That medicine worked great.

  B: Yes, it had instantaneous results.

  instantaneous

  a. 瞬间的,即刻的

  A: What are the words to that song you were humming?

  B: Oh, it was just an instrumental piece.

  instrumental

  a. 1.起作用的,有帮助的;2.用乐器演奏的

  A: My house is freezing in the winter.

  B: Perhaps you need to insulate it better.

  insulate

  vt. 1.使绝缘,使隔热,使隔音;2.隔离,使隔绝(以免受到影响)

  A: Did the parcel arrive intact?

  B: Yes, there was no damage to it at all.

  intact

  a. 完整无缺的,未经触动的,未受损伤的

  A: What is the annual intake of students into your school each year?

  B: Oh, about 100 pupils join each year.

  intake

  n. 1.吸入,纳入;2.进气口,入口

  A: You played an integral part in the project, thanks for your help.

  B: You are welcome, but I do not think that my assistance was that important.

  integral

  a. 构成整体所必需的,基本的

  A: I admire your integrity.

  B: Thanks, I think it is essential to stick to your principles.

  integrity

  n. 1.正直,诚实,诚恳;2.完整,完全,完善

  A: My intellect is the most important aspect of my mind.

  A: And you certainly use your well.

  intellect

  n. 1.智力,理解力;2.才智非凡的人

  A: Mark always holds intelligible conversation.

  B: Yes, he is very smart.

  intelligible

  a. 可理解的,明白易懂的,清楚的

  A: We could intensify the light in the room by painting the walls white.

  B: Or we could just add more lights.

  intensify

  v. (使)增强,(使)加剧

  A: I did not commit the crime with intent.

  B: But that will be impossible to prove in court.

  intent

  n. 意图,意向,目的

  a. 1.专心的,转注的;2.急切的

  to all intents 几乎在一切方面,实际上

  A: I need to interact with some new people.

  B: Good , but how are you going to meet them?

  interact

  vi. 相互作用,相互影响

  A: I think our post has been intercepted.

  B: Why, were the letters open when they arrived?

  intercept

  vt. 拦截,截住,截击

  A: The conference facilitated intercourse with many groups of people.

  B: I hope that you had some interesting and productive conversations.

  intercourse

  n. 1.性交;2.交流,交往,交际

  A: What do you study in college?

  B: The interface between humans and computers

  interface

  n. 1.接口;2.界面,交接处

  v. 互相作用(或影响,联系),互相配合工作

  A: We have to submit an interim report by the end of the month.

  B: And when will the official one have to be completed?

  interim

  a. 暂时的,临时的

  n. 间歇,过度期间

  in the interim 在其间

  A: May I offer an interjection into the argument?

  B: No, the debate must continue without disruption.

  interjection

  n. 1.感叹词;2.(突然的)插入

  A: How was the weather on your holiday?

  B: Apart form the intermittent rain, it was fine.

  intermittent

  a. 间歇的,断断续续的

  A: Turn left at the next intersection.

  B: I thought we have to turn right.

  intersection

  n. 1.横断,交叉;2.道路交叉口,交点

  A: My parents are always arguing.

  B: Is there anything you can do to intervene?

  intervene

  vi. 1干涉,干预;2.干扰,阻挠

  A: I am planning an intervention into the affairs of my neighbours.

  B: Why are you so interested in what they are doing ?

  intervention

  n. 介入,干涉,干预

  A: Jane is always so outspoken.

  B: But don’t be intimidated by her.

  intimidate

  vt. 恐吓,威胁

  A: He was completely intoxicated after coming home from the pub last night.

  B: Yes, I knew he had a lot to drink.

  intoxicate

  vt. 1.使喝醉;2.使陶醉,使欣喜若狂

  A: The details in the painting are exceptionally intricate.

  B: Yes, it must have taken a long time to complete.

  intricate

  a. 错综复杂的,复杂精细的

  A: Did you enjoy the novel I lent you?

  B: It was excellent, the plot was full of intrigue and mystery.

  intrigue

  vt. 激起...的好奇心(或兴趣),迷住

  vi. 耍阴谋,施诡计

  n. 阴谋,诡计,密谋

  A: I found a piece of evidence that is intrinsic to our case.

  B: Gosh, why did we not realize it sooner?

  intrinsic

  a. 固有的,本质的,内在的

  A: I don’t mean to intrude, but can I join your conversation?

  B: Don’t worry, you are not interrupting anything private.

  intrude

  vi. 侵入,侵扰,打扰

  A: My intuition told me that he is bad news.

  B: Yes, I never trusted him either.

  intuition

  n. 直觉

  A: I am afraid this is the only piece of identification that I have.

  B: But it is out of date which makes it invalid.

  invalid

  a. 1.(指法律上)无效的,作废的;2.无可靠根据的,站不住脚的

  n. (需要有人照顾的)病弱者,残疾者

  A: Your help was invaluable to me, thanks.

  B: Don’t mention it, it was my pleasure.

  invaluable

  a. 非常宝贵的,极为贵重的,无价的

  A: Invariably the car broke down on the way to my exam.

  B: Typical! What did you do?

  invariably

  ad. 不变地,始终如一地,总是

  A: I would like to have an inventory of all the furniture in the house before I move in.

  B: Certainly, that can be arranged.

  inventory

  n. 详细目录,存货清单

  make inventory 清查存货,存货盘存;调查;评价

  A: I can’t get the lid off this jar, Mum.

  B: Try inverting it and then bang the jar on the floor.

  invert

  vt. 使倒转,使倒置,使颠倒

  A: Ironically, I missed the plane even though I was at the airport two hours in advance.

  B: I call that unlucky!

  ironically

  ad. 1.具有讽刺意味地;2.嘲讽地,挖苦地

  A: Do you think Jack is a good comedian?

  B: No, he relies too heavily on irony.

  irony

  n. 1.反语,冷嘲;2.具有讽刺意味的事,嘲弄

  A: Irrespective of the weather, I think we should still go sailing.

  B: But what if there is a thunder storm?

  irrespective

  a. 不考虑的,不顾及的

  A: Despite the dry weather, I am amazed at how many crops the farmers are growing.

  B: That is because they have developed an extensive and efficient irrigation system.

  irrigation

  n. 灌溉

  A: My little sister always irritates me.

  B: Mine is also very annoying.

  irritate

  vt. 1.使恼怒,使烦躁;2.使(身体某部分)不适,使疼痛

  A: Is Iran a Christian country?

  B: No, it is Islamic.

  Islamic

  a. 伊斯兰教的,伊斯兰教信徒的

  A: The isle where we camped was just one hour by boat off shore.

  B: Were there any inhabitants on it?

  isle

  n. 小岛,岛

  A: I’m itching to travel.

  B: Perhaps you can go away following your studies.

  itch

  vi. 1.痒,发痒;2.渴望,热望

  vt. 使发痒

  A: Your necklace is very unusual.

  B: That’s because it is made out of ivory.

  ivory

  n. 1.象牙;2.象牙色,乳白色

  A: I need to cut back the ivy from my windows.

  B: Yes, it tends to grow at a rapid rate.

  ivy

  n. 常春藤

  J

  A: I need to change the wheel of my car, I have a flat.

  B: I’ll help, do you have a jack ?

  jack

  n. 千斤顶

  vt. 1.用千斤顶顶起;2。停止,放弃;3。提高,增加

  A: What type of stone is your ring?

  B: It is jade , quite rare.

  jade

  n. 1。玉,翡翠;2。浅绿(色)

  A: Did you understand the article I gave you?

  B: No, there was too much jargon and terms that I had not seen before.

  jargon

  n. 术语,行话

  A: I’m going to rent a jeep for the weekend and drive to the mountains.

  B: Great idea, can I come?

  jeep

  n. 吉普车

  A: No, I’m not going to cheat on the exam.

  B: Good, there is no point in jeopardising your degree.

  jeopardise

  vt. 危机,损害

  A: You nearly hit Andrew on the head.

  B: Good thing that he jerked just in time to miss it.

  jerk

  vt. 使猝然一动,猛拉

  vi. 猝然一动

  n. 急推,急拉,急扭

  A: What would you like for your birthday?

  B: Some new jewellery would be nice, maybe a necklace.

  jewellery

  n. 珠宝,首饰

  A: You’re so small you would make an excellent jockey .

  B: Oh, I don’t like horse riding.

  jockey

  n. 1。骑师;2。[美俚]驾驶员,(机器等的)操作手

  vi. 谋取

  vt. 劝说,诱使

  A: I go for a short jog around the lake every night.

  B: You must be very fit.

  jog

  v. / n. 1。慢跑;2。(尤指不正当地)轻轻碰撞

  jog sb.’s memory 唤起某人的记忆

  A: Mr. Smith has a jolly sense of humour,

  B: Yes, I have always found him to be very pleasant.

  jolly

  a. 快乐的,高兴的,愉快的

  ad. 很,非常

  vt. 劝服,哄

  A: Was the car damaged in the accident?

  B: No, it just got a slight jolt . There was no damage done.

  jolt

  vt. 1。使颠簸,使摇晃;2。使震惊

  vi. 颠簸,摇晃

  n. 1。震动,摇动,颠簸;2。震惊

  A: The judicial proceedings will take place after all the evidence has been collected.

  B: How long do you think that will take?

  judicial

  a. 1。司法的,法庭的,审判的;2。明断的,公正的

  A: Shall I pour the milk into a jug ?

  B: Yes, if you can find a clean one!

  jug

  n. 1。大罐,壶;2。一大罐(壶)的容量

  A: I’m trying to juggle two jobs at once.

  B: That must be difficult, how do you manage?

  juggle

  v. 1。(用球等)玩杂耍;2。尽力应付,力图平衡;3。篡改(数字等)以图掩盖

  A: There is a jumbo edition of the magazine out this week.

  B: Are you sure you will have time to read it?

  jumbo

  a. 特大的,巨型的

  n. 大型喷气式飞机

  A: The traffic lights on the main junction are out this week.

  B: Are you sure you will have time to read it ?

  junction

  n. 联结点,(道路等的)会合点,枢纽
